**Ticket: Nightly Backfill Scheduler — Plugin API Sign-off**

The Quillhaven scheduler now exposes hooks so external plugin authors can register backfill jobs for the nightly window. Plugins must declare expected runtime, retry policy, and data-range bounds; jobs exceeding declared limits are suspended automatically. Before this interface is frozen and published, we need sign-off confirming the contract is stable and the sandbox restrictions are adequate. Final approval rests with the engineer listed below.

account owner for kafop-haweg: Pelax Gilael Istir

### v2.14 — Perchpoint health checks

Support team, good news: we fixed the flappy health checks behind the Coastline load balancer. The old check hit a cold endpoint and timed out under load, so nodes got yanked for no reason. New check uses a lightweight readiness probe with a 5s grace window. Fewer false "node down" tickets, hopefully. Questions go to the owner listed below.

named custodian: Brivan Eliath Quenox Frador

# Break-Glass Access: Cataloglade Cache Invalidation

If the Cataloglade product catalog serves stale prices and the normal invalidation pipeline is down, break-glass access lets you flush the edge cache directly. Use this only when the Pricewick queue has been backed up for more than 30 minutes and on-call leadership has been paged. The flush console requires two confirmations and logs every action. To unseal the break-glass credential bundle, enter the recovery passphrase shown below.

recovery phrase for fajeg-hagug: holox-fenmir

Runbook: Fleetgauge fuel-usage report

The weekly fuel report aggregates Fleetgauge telemetry for all Dunmarsh depots. Runs Sundays 02:00. If the job stalls, check the Ironbarrow aggregator lag first; over 30 min lag means rerun with the catch-up flag. Never rerun mid-aggregation — totals double. Output lands in the reports bucket. The job reads the following configuration at launch.

service settings:
[silwyn]
host = silwyn.crelvogrid.internal
user = silwyn_svc
database = silwyn_prod